Plan First

If you plan to grow your business, remember that the tools with which you use to operate your company will have to grow with you, too. That includes your technology. While it may be tempting to buy new gadgets for your staff or conference room, first create a game plan for a system that can support all of those emerging applications

Think of the types of cables that will be required, the lengths of those cables, the bandwidth needed to support your connected system, and the likelihood of potential wire expansion. A solid plan from the beginning keeps your cabling clean, safe, and reliable.

Organize Your Wires

Troubleshooting technological problems will happen from time to time, which means having to go behind the scenes and check out your network. If your cable system looks like a tangled spiderweb, the troubleshooting process will only be more of a headache as you navigate through the mess.

Instead, keep your cables organized in small bundles with zip ties or Velcro straps, which allows for simple adjustment and provides support for your heavy wires. Color coding your wires to their specific function is also a reliable way to stay organized and save valuable time when trying to solve a network hiccup or audio/visual issue.

Use the Correct Components

Though you may save some change by using cheap cables from the start, you’ll wind up spending more over time to constantly replace them. Invest in high-quality, name-brand cabling and components to keep maintenance costs at bay and to ensure a robust backbone for your business.

Also, choosing the right cables for your work environment contributes to a safe space and a more reliable network by keeping your business in line with electrical code that must be followed when expanding your office.
